Located south of the Kansas Speedway and west of the I-435 corridor, Edwardsville is among the areas most prosperous communities, featuring a balanced approach of development and strong, but manageable, growth. The city also benefits from excellent schools and public services, but perhaps its best feature (according to many residents) is its blend of a rural, small-town atmosphere and its accessibility to all that is offered by a larger metropolitan region.
The Police Department is currently staffed with 16 sworn full-time officers and 1 civilian employee who serves as administrative assistant and assistant court clerk. Every member of our organization is committed to providing the finest service possible in a fair, impartial, and professional manner.
